Transaction 890655df2614a81fd3cb689139e9c4a425f41a0d34e464b4e407ba7bfc7650ec
1 Input
1 Output
-
890655df2614a81fd3cb689139e9c4a425f41a0d34e464b4e407ba7bfc7650ec:0
- value
- 174021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a27ee35b5448851bf2f7d57c4f55fceb7386b03 OP_EQUAL
- address
- 3QVigvQbpYGYofTGfR2e9sA27r9NLBfzCb